The United States Government has described Africa as one of the “most important emerging regions in the world” saying President Barack Obama will be using his visit to Africa to strengthen U.S. relations, increase trade and investment opportunities, and improve engagement by American businesses. A White House statement said Mr. Obama will be responding to the “high demand signal from the U.S. private sector for us to play an active role in deepening our trade and investment partnerships in Africa” by seeking greater participation of the private sector in the countries he will be visiting. Mr. Israel O. Oparaoji is a real estate expert located in Lekki area of Lagos State. He founded Johncassidy properties & investment limited to provide real estate services throughout the country and is considered a leader in the real estate industry. In this interview with the Business Dispatch, he shares his journey into the property market. Who is Mr Oparaoji please? My name is Israel Onyeawuna Oparaoji . I hail from Imo State, Nigeria, second son of the family of seven. I came from Nazareth where people thought nothing good can come out from. I came to Lagos in 1990 as a barber after I dropped out of primary education because of finance. After that I met a man by name Rev. Pastor John Elenamah the founder of World Revival Ministries who eventually gave me shelter and mentored me after seven years of leaving the street. He played a special role in my life by fathering and mentoring me. In 2007 I entered into real estate business not just to make money and become rich overnight No! but to add values to humanity because I have been there before. Mr. Israel, what do you consider some of the challenges of Nigeria’s real Estate, wiht personal challenges? The major challenges facing people like us in the real estate industry has to do with other colleagues not honouring their agreement with other parties. But to us before we enter into any transaction with anybody, we first document the transaction before moving forward. What should landlords look for in tenants? Every landlord only looks for tenants that would not constitute nuisance in his/her compound. As you can see a rested mind is the mind that achieves success especially when it comes to business so when there are people living in your house that make a lot of noise and all sorts then you are in trouble as a landlord/landlady. Having said that, another challenge I feel facing the industry is when someone doesn’t pay his/her bills on time, paying their rent will likely be a low priority to them. References from previous landlords is crucial as well How does your company stand apart from its competition? At Johncassidy properties & investment limited we provide what I call first class services in making sure that we first listen to our clients to know exactly what they really want. Secondly, we have what is called extra ordinary contacts because success in business is all about extra ordinary contacts that you have. For example if a client gives you a brief to buy or rent a property for him/her in a particular location if you don’t know how to go about it, that makes you a failure automatically. Please can you tell us how you made your first One Million Naira through your real estate business? You know in life, God always position people on your way to greatness. In 2008 I met a man called Chief Leo Stan Ekeh the chairman of Zinox Group (The Computer Guru). This great man brought me to where I am today by giving me an opportunity to transact two colossal properties in Lagos even though I have done other transactions after that, but I will not forget to be grateful to God and also to him. I personally see him as an agent of change to my life. How do you see the future of this industry? I believe that property business is a business that brings both the poor and the rich together, first you must understand why you are venturing into real estate business. Secondly, you must have integrity and dignity. What do I mean by that? Dignity in you tells you not to do what is wrong even when no one is there with you. Before Johncassidy properties & investment limited was registered I personally encountered a lot of cases where people that you so much trusted turned you down by not honouring your agreement with them. Thirdly, I urge the federal government with all concern to partner with indigenous industries and entrepreneurs like us to partner together to lift a greater Nigeria by providing infrastructure and also giving land allocation to investors both foreign and local in order to create jobs to the average Nigerian because I believe crime can only stop by job creation. Where do you see yourself in five years? If you desire to be rich you must respect those that are already rich. In the real estate industry I have mentors and fathers who believes in me as a young Nigerian who is working hard to become the best that I can be in life. In five years from now Johncassidy properties & investment limited will become a household name like when one mentions Chief Kola Akomolade. Final remarks sir? As an Imo State indigene what do you have for the young people who are aspiring be like you in the state? First and foremost, we must not forget to thank God for giving us a man who has good vision for the masses which is the new governor, Governor Owele Rochas Okorocha. I was been invited by him during his campaign rally in the state. I have never met him before but after seeing him and also working with him during his campaign rally, I personally appreciated God for giving us such a man as a leader. Why do I say this? Governor Owele Rochas Okorocha stood as an agent of change in bringing youths into their God giving destinies and also empowering them through free education which we must not forget in hurry that today’s Awolowo is in Imo state and not in Yoruba land. For me, I believe through my real estate profession Johncassidy properties & investment limited is going to set a platform where we can partner with Imo State government in empowering the youths to become all they want to become through education.
